About N. R. Patel
N. R. Patel is a scholar working on Global and Planetary Change, Ecology and Environmental Engineering, having authored 44 papers that have together received 1.2k ind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(30 papers), Plant Water Relations and Carbon Dynamics (19 papers) and Climate variability and models (8 papers). The work is most often cited by research in Global and Planetary Change (863 citations), Environmental Engineering (302 citations) and Ecology (495 citations). N. R. Patel has collaborated with scholars based in India, United States and Germany. Frequent co-authors include Sudip Saha, Arnab Kundu, Dipanwita Dutta, V. K. Dadhwal, Azizur Rahman Siddiqui, Bikash Ranjan Parida, Shashi Kumar, Valentijn Venus, Taibanganba Watham and S. P. S. Kushwaha.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Journal of Hydrology.
